Association Plate-forme Télécom Com4Innov, a mobile network operating in France, Europe, distinguishes itself with the Mobile Country Code (MCC) 208 and Mobile Network Code (MNC) 92. Focusing on telecommunications innovation, Com4Innov plays a key role in fostering advancements within the French mobile ecosystem. While France boasts several established mobile operators, such as Orange, SFR, and Bouygues Telecom, Com4Innov occupies a unique position, often collaborating on research and development projects related to future telecommunications technologies. They contribute towards shaping the direction of mobile communications within France and potentially across Europe through experimental deployments and collaborative test beds. The network serves as a platform for testing new technologies and services, providing a valuable resource for researchers, developers, and businesses. This focus differentiates Com4Innov from mainstream commercial mobile operators which primarily prioritize consumer subscriptions. Its infrastructure and operations provide a sandbox environment where novel mobile applications and network architectures can be explored outside the constraints and risks associated with launching them directly on a large-scale commercial network.
